At first glance, it sounds like a holy grail—a rare, exclusive version of THQ’s 2011 hit WWE '12 running on Sony’s legendary PlayStation 2. However, there is a massive catch that every wrestling fan needs to understand before hunting for this file.
The answer lies in the modding community. The "WWE 12 PS2 ISO" is not an official retail disc dump. Instead, it is a —a ROM hack of SmackDown vs. Raw 2011 . Modders took the SvR 2011 engine (the last PS2 wrestling game) and poured hundreds of hours into replacing textures, character models, arena assets, and even menu screens to mirror the PS3/Xbox 360 version of WWE ’12.
